High-end Outdoor Camping vs RV Camping: Which Is Better?




The great outdoors has actually never ever been so comfortable. Gone are the days when hanging around in nature indicated roughing it on a thin resting pad or battling with a persistent camp range. Today, 2 designs of raised outdoor traveling are contending for the hearts of modern travelers: deluxe outdoor camping (often called glamping) and RV camping. Both assure a purposeful connection with nature without giving up comfort-- yet they provide that pledge in really various means. So which one is really better?

The honest answer depends entirely on what type of tourist you are. Let's simplify.

What Is Luxury Camping (Glamping)?



Luxury camping, or glamping, refers to pre-set accommodations in natural settings that mix the charm of the outdoors with hotel-like facilities. Think safari outdoors tents with plush king beds, treehouse resorts with exclusive decks, geodesic domes with stargazing skylights, or yurts outfitted with wood-burning cooktops and comfy carpets.

The essential appeal is simpleness. You show up, and whatever is currently there waiting for you-- no arrangement, no packing lists that stretch 3 pages long, and no concessions on convenience.

Pros of Luxury Camping



Glamping is ideal for individuals that enjoy the idea of nature however do not like the logistics of traditional camping. It's additionally a fantastic selection for pairs seeking a charming getaway, family members presenting little ones to the outdoors, or anybody that wants an aesthetically spectacular, Instagram-worthy experience.

The majority of glamping websites are curated locations in themselves-- usually located on private land, vineyards, national park boundaries, or seaside high cliffs. The place is part of the package. You don't need to study camping sites or worry about accessibility at popular areas months in advance (though reserving in advance is still wise).

Disadvantages of Deluxe Outdoor Camping



The most significant disadvantage is price. Glamping accommodations can run anywhere from $150 to over $1,000 per night, putting them firmly in the store resort rate variety. You're likewise secured right into one area for your keep, which limits the feeling of freedom and exploration that many individuals associate with outdoor camping.

What Is RV Outdoor camping?



RV camping includes taking a trip in a motorhome, camper van, or a car towing a trailer that works as your mobile home. You prepare your own dishes, sleep in your very own room, and awaken wherever you parked-- whether that's a lakeside camping site, a desert overlook, or a national park.

RVing is the classic road-trip dream totally realized. Your home trips with you, which suggests you can follow the weather condition, chase after sunsets, or just transform your mind concerning where you're do without any type of fine.

Pros of Motor Home Camping



Liberty is the specifying advantage of recreational vehicle travel. You're not tied to one location. A single two-week journey can take you through mountain woodlands, seaside towns, and canyon landscapes-- all from the convenience of your own rolling living-room.

RVing likewise becomes even more economical with time. Once you have or rent a recreational vehicle, your accommodation expenses are substantially less than hotels or glamping websites. Camping site charges at nationwide and state parks commonly vary from $20 to $50 per evening, making extended travel surprisingly affordable. Households, specifically, can discover this style of travel far more affordable than conventional getaways.

There's likewise something deeply satisfying concerning the self-sufficiency of RV life. You lug your kitchen, your bedroom, and your bathroom with you-- it constructs a sense of capability and freedom that few traveling designs can match.

Disadvantages of RV Outdoor Camping



RVing includes real duties. Keeping a car, managing waste systems, learning to back into tight campgrounds, and managing the periodic mechanical hiccup all require patience and a willingness to problem-solve. The knowing contour, specifically for first-timers, can be steep.

Arrangement and traveling also take time. Driving a motor home is slower and much more exhausting than a routine journey, and getting to a new site includes leveling the lorry, linking utilities, and getting worked out-- which can eat into your journey time.

So, Which Is Much better?



Luxury camping wins if you desire a curated, easy retreat with no logistics. It's a destination experience, best for a vacation or an unique event.

Recreational vehicle outdoor camping wins if you yearn for flexibility, adaptability, and the excitement of discovering numerous position on a solitary trip. It rewards those that delight in the trip as much as the location.

The most effective choice isn't actually concerning which style is fairly superior-- it's about knowing yourself as a vacationer. Whether you're sipping wine in a canvas tent under the stars or developing coffee at a picnic table beside your motorhome, nature has a method of supplying exactly what you came for.
